Output 790a297328a33a988314db97d3d3d6f0bda082ff7293bbb2efce7ccef26dc941:2

value
29044994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ae8a507852f655e55c38485fd0a228751793d564 OP_EQUAL
address
MPp3W4GkzVZcq5LZMZCDwceDKg57qHwky1
transaction
790a297328a33a988314db97d3d3d6f0bda082ff7293bbb2efce7ccef26dc941
spent
true